The per-transaction average — $29 — is the number that tells you what kind of spending this is. A few dollars means meals at product presentations, reported by the thousand. Hundreds or thousands means consulting, speaking or royalty arrangements with a much smaller group of physicians. Across all 347 providers the average total is $54, but that average hides a very steep distribution.
